Exploring the Epic History and Success of Castle Rock Entertainment
Castle Rock Entertainment is a renowned film and television production company founded in 1987 by Rob Reiner, Martin Shafer, Glenn Padnick, Andrew Scheinman, and Alan Horn. Over the years, Castle Rock has produced numerous blockbuster films and hit TV shows, solidifying its reputation as one of the most successful production companies in the entertainment industry.
